Which tool is commonly used to verify pulley alignment in industrial setups?

Explanation:
Verifying pulley alignment requires measuring both how parallel the shafts are and whether they share a common centerline. A laser alignment tool is the standard choice because it can quickly and precisely detect both angular misalignment and offset over the span between pulleys. By projecting a laser and using sensors or targets, you get clear readouts that guide adjustments to motor bases or idlers, reducing belt wear, vibration, and energy loss. Tape measures only provide rough distances and can’t reliably capture angular or runout errors over the distance between pulleys. Vernier calipers and micrometers are meant for small, static dimensions and aren’t practical for aligning distant rotating components. The laser method offers the most practical, accurate verification for pulley alignment.
